Smuggler Cove

A nearly landlocked, all-weather anchorage tucked behind a maze of islets near Secret Cove, Smuggler Cove is one of the most popular and protected hidey-holes on the Sunshine Coast.

About this Anchorage

Smuggler Cove Marine Provincial Park sits on the south side of the Sechelt Peninsula, just inside Welcome Passage about 16 km west of Sechelt. Behind its tight, rock-guarded entrance the cove opens into three small, interconnected basins ringed by rocky, forested shoreline and low islets, giving it a reputation as a genuine all-weather refuge.

BC Parks has set 38 stern-tie rings into the rocky shore, so most boats anchor bow-out and run a stern line to the rocks; with stern-ties the cove can pack in roughly 20 vessels. The innermost basins offer the snuggest, best-protected spots, while the first basin inside the entrance is larger but more exposed to wakes.

The park is closed to sewage discharge by federal regulation, so holding tanks are mandatory. A trail network winds through the surrounding wetland park, and dinghy shore access lets crews stretch their legs ashore.

Approaches & Known Hazards

Approach notes, hazards to watch for, and what's available once you're tied up.

The entrance from Welcome Passage is narrow and rock-bound, only about 15 m (50 ft) wide between a shoal patch carrying roughly 3 ft of water and two drying rocks lying about 30 m off Capri Isle. The approach doglegs through the islets, and entry is best made near low tide when the reefs and projecting rocks are visible.

Once inside, proceed dead-slow with a constant watch on the depth sounder: the bottom is irregular with rocks and shoals hiding just below the surface, and kelp marks many of the foul patches. Drying and projecting reefs continue between the basins, so a careful eye on the chart (CHS 3535 / 3311) and a bow lookout are essential.
